A short path to the right operator.
The contact flow uses NoticeAPI's own inbound and operator tooling, so the context stays attached from form to reply.
- 01POSTThe form validates the note
Required fields, request size, rate limits, bot checks, and the selected sales or support topic are checked first.
- 02ROUTEIt enters operator triage
The same inbound workflow used for the public mailboxes routes the message into the operator queue and sends an alert.
- 03REPLYA person answers your email
The reply goes to the work email on the form, usually within one business day.
